Stone Angel said:
One more section you may want to add is a misc. section one that contains stuff for some impromptu ideas. Pub conversations, rumors (truthful or not) maps (real and fake) NPC name list, Town list. A sort of first aid kit for when parties go "off the map". Good luck

That's the primary intent of the reference section, actually. :) Tables of names and things, stat blocks for generic NPCs, etc.
